21 3. At the end of each fiscal year the department
22 shall determine the balance of unencumbered and
23 unobligated moneys in the assessment account of the
24 animal agriculture compliance fund created pursuant to
25 section 455B.127. If on that date the balance of
26 unencumbered and unobligated moneys in the account is
27 one million dollars or more, the department shall
28 adjust the rate of the annual compliance fee for the
29 following fiscal year. The adjusted rate for the
30 annual compliance fee shall be based on the
31 department's estimate of the amount required to ensure
32 that at the end of the following fiscal year the
33 balance of unencumbered and unobligated moneys in the
34 assessment account is not one million dollars or more.
